The whitewashed walls, blue domes, caldera views, cliffside cafés, boat days, sunset dinners, and narrow cobblestone streets all create the kind of backdrop where your outfit suddenly matters a little more.

But the secret is choosing looks that are beautiful and practical. Santorini can be hot and sunny in summer, so breathable fabrics like linen and cotton, flowy dresses, loose shorts, chic swim cover-ups, sun hats, sunglasses, and flat sandals are genuinely useful — especially when exploring Oia, Fira, beaches, and village streets.

✨ Santorini Accessories Essentials

AccessoryWhy It Works
Flat leather sandalsBetter for cobblestone streets and village walking
Woven tote bagLooks coastal and carries sunscreen, phone, and camera
Oversized sunglassesAdds glam while helping with bright island sun 😭
Wide-brim hatPerfect for sun protection and vacation photos
Gold hoop earringsMakes simple linen outfits feel elegant
Raffia clutchIdeal for sunset dinners and rooftop cafés
Silk scarfWorks as a hair scarf, bag accent, or breezy styling detail
Comfortable dressy sandalsUseful for dinners without struggling in heels

1. The Whitewashed Street Look That Feels Like a Dreamy Postcard 🤍

✨ Style Formula

White cotton halter maxi dress • tan Greek leather sandals • woven half-moon bag • gold hoop earrings • oversized sunglasses

This outfit feels made for Santorini’s whitewashed streets 😭 The halter maxi gives soft movement while flat leather sandals keep it practical for stairs, village walks, and dreamy photo stops around Oia.

📍 Occasion: Oia exploring • caldera photos • village cafés

13. The Black Sand Beach Look That Feels Cool and Practical 🖤

✨ Style Formula

Black ribbed tank dress • white oversized gauze shirt • tan flat sandals • straw tote • silver hoop earrings

This outfit works beautifully for Santorini’s black sand beach days because it feels casual but styled. The gauze shirt adds coverage from the sun, while the tank dress keeps everything easy and comfortable.

📍 Occasion: Perissa beach • Kamari beach • casual seaside lunches
